Theories and Applications of Quantum Annealing: A Literature Survey

BaoNan Wang,HengHua Shui,Sumin Wang,Feng Hu,Chao Wang
DOI: https://doi.org/10.1360/sspma-2020-0409
2021-01-01
Abstract:Quantum annealing (QA) algorithm is a new quantum optimization algorithm based on the classical simulated annealing (SA) algorithm. Unlike classical SA algorithm, which uses the thermal waves to search for the optimal solution, the QA algorithm uses the quantum tunneling effect to allow a quantum to penetrate a potential barrier with a higher energy than itself. Therefore, the algorithm can get rid of the local extreme values and is more likely to approach the global optimal with higher probability. In the literature, the QA algorithm has shown perfect optimization effects on combinatorial optimization problems. In this paper, the basic concepts and application fields of QA algorithm, which is the core principle of D-Wave quantum computer, are systematically reviewed. The applications of QA algorithm in cryptography, traveling salesman problem, graph coloring problem, and traffic path are discussed in detail. In addition, the direction of future research for QA algorithm is explored.
What problem does this paper attempt to address?